Techniques Used in Professional Concrete Repair


Experts use various proven techniques to fix concrete issues. A frequently adopted method involves epoxy injection, which closes cracks and strengthens the surrounding material. It is particularly effective for severe cracks that might undermine the structure. Patching is an alternative method used to restore small or localized damage, providing a seamless appearance without noticeable repairs.


Other techniques comprise grinding rough surfaces to create a new finish and applying sealers guarding against moisture and chemicals. These methods, often combined in a repair project, help extend the life of your concrete surfaces and maintain their appearance. Coatings come in a variety of types, each with its own benefits. Epoxy finishes are popular for their long-lasting durability and stain resistance, rendering them perfect for high-traffic areas. Urethane and acrylic coatings add flexibility and a distinct visual appeal that suits both residential and commercial settings, appealing to clients in locations such as Pewaukee and Hartland.

Stamped Concrete Styles and Trends in Waukesha


Stamped concrete has become a popular choice due to its capacity to mimic natural materials. In Waukesha, numerous property owners opt for stamped designs that provide the look of stone or brick at a fraction of the cost. Popular patterns include geometric shapes, cobblestones, and even wood grain textures that add warmth to outdoor areas.
